SUBJECT IMPLIES HE HAS WEAPON – ELIZABETH, NJ

On 11/2/23, at 9:05 p.m., a jewelry kiosk inside a mall reported a grab and run theft had occurred. A lone male approached the kiosk at closing, and insisted on looking at a chain and charm. When presented the items, the subject grabbed them, and fled out of the mall. Mall security was contacted and the Elizabeth Police Department responded at 10:00 p.m., to take a report. In speaking with the store team, it was later learned that the subject was holding his waist with one hand, inferring he had a weapon during the entire interaction. There were no injuries and Elizabeth PD will continue the investigation.
